The International Trade Center (ITC) is a joint agency of the World Trade Organization, and the United Nations dedicated to supporting the internationalization of small and medium-sized enterprises. ITC provides trade-related technical assistance and promotes inclusive and sustainable trade development, helping businesses in developing and transitioning economies become more competitive in global markets.

As part of our collaboration with ITC, Caribbean Export is an active participant in the GreentoCompete Hub. This initiative aims to:
- Promote Sustainable Practices: The GreentoCompete Hub supports businesses in adopting sustainable practices and green technologies, helping them reduce their environmental footprint and improve resource efficiency.
- Enhance Market Access: The hub provides training and resources to help businesses meet international sustainability standards, enabling them to access new markets and meet the growing demand for eco-friendly products and services.
- Support Green Innovation: By fostering innovation in sustainable business practices, the GreentoCompete Hub helps businesses develop new green products and services, driving economic growth and environmental sustainability.
Through the GreentoCompete Hub, Caribbean Export and ITC are empowering Caribbean businesses to embrace sustainability, enhancing their competitiveness in the global market while contributing to a greener future.
